The much-anticipated Indian Ocean Craft Triennial (IOTA) is set to return with its second edition after its momentous debut in 2021. Spanning three months, August to October 2024, this extraordinary event promises to be a vibrant celebration of contemporary craft and cultural exchange of the Indian Ocean Region.

The international exhibition at the heart of IOTA24 will highlight the work of 32 craft artists and groups from six Indian Ocean countries—India, Indonesia, Malaysia, South Africa, Yemen, including First Nations Australia, and Australians of IOR heritage. The Major Exhibition Partners of Fremantle Arts Centre, John Curtin Gallery and Holmes à Court Gallery, will be supported by a further 50+ galleries and art spaces who will present IOTA-specific exhibitions and events from Esperance to Broome.

The Heritage Collective theatre hosts a unique opportunity to hear from the curators of IOTA24 before the program is made public on 31 May 2024.
